1. General Information
-
Aircraft Name & Model: Bombardier Challenger 350
-
Manufacturer: Bombardier Aerospace
-
Year of Manufacture: 2014 – Present
-
Price:
-
New: ~$26.7 million USD
-
Pre-Owned: ~$14–22 million USD
-
-
Category: Super-Midsize Jet
2. Performance & Capabilities
-
Maximum Cruise Speed: 448 knots (515 mph / 829 km/h)
-
Maximum Range: 3,200 nautical miles (5,926 km)
-
Service Ceiling: 45,000 feet (13,716 meters)
-
Rate of Climb: 4,200 feet per minute
-
Takeoff Distance: 4,835 feet (1,474 meters)
-
Landing Distance: 2,364 feet (720 meters)
-
Fuel Efficiency: ~770 gallons per hour
-
Runway Compatibility: Operates on short runways & challenging airports
3. Interior & Cabin Features
-
Cabin Dimensions:
-
Length: 25.2 ft (7.68 m)
-
Width: 7.2 ft (2.19 m)
-
Height: 6.1 ft (1.85 m)
-
-
Seating Capacity:
-
Standard: 8–10 passengers
-
Maximum: Up to 10 passengers
-
-
VIP Layouts: Club seating with executive tables, divans, swivel recliners
-
Galley: Full galley with microwave, oven, espresso maker, chilled storage
-
Sleeping Capacity: 3–4 with convertible flatbeds
-
Lavatories: 1 full aft lavatory with vanity
-
Cabin Pressurization: 9.4 psi; comfortable cabin altitude at max cruise
-
Windows: 14 large panoramic windows with electrostatic dimming
-
Inflight Connectivity: High-speed Ka-band WiFi available
-
Entertainment: Full HD screens, Bluetooth audio, surround sound system
-
Office Facilities: Executive work tables, power ports, phone connectivity
-
Luxury Features: Smart cabin control via personal device, leather seats, mood lighting
-
Baggage Capacity: 106 cubic feet (3 m³), accessible during flight
-
Pet-Friendly: Yes – with custom pet comfort options
4. Exterior & Design
-
Length: 68.7 ft (20.9 m)
-
Wingspan: 69 ft (21 m)
-
Height: 20.3 ft (6.2 m)
-
Material: High-strength aluminum & composite materials
-
Paint & Livery: Fully customizable exterior paint options
-
Door Type: Built-in airstair for easy boarding
-
Noise Level: Quiet cabin, Stage 4 compliant (inside & out)
5. Avionics & Safety Features
-
Flight Deck: Collins Pro Line 21 Advanced
-
Cockpit Configuration: Full glass cockpit, optional Heads-Up Display (HUD)
-
Autopilot & Nav Systems: Synthetic Vision System, Dual FMS, Auto-throttle
-
Advanced Safety: TCAS II, Enhanced Ground Proximity Warning System (EGPWS), Runway Awareness
-
Weather Radar: Advanced color radar with turbulence detection
-
Emergency Features: Fire suppression systems, oxygen masks, life vests
6. Engine & Powertrain
-
Engine Manufacturer: Honeywell
-
Engine Model: HTF7350
-
Number of Engines: 2
-
Thrust: 7,323 lbs each
-
Fuel Type: Jet-A
-
Eco-Friendly Features: Advanced noise suppression, low emissions, compliant with green standards
